Trailers

Trailers recorded $192.4 million of federal contract obligations for this product or service in fiscal year 2026, which ranks 347 of 2,291 products and services with a figure in FY2026.

By fiscal year

Trailers: federal contract obligations for this product or service, by fiscal year
Fiscal yearObligated
FY2022$238,624,145
FY2023$265,050,667
FY2024$164,879,585
FY2025$246,351,430
FY2026$192,436,320

The publisher holds five fiscal years of this breakdown. A year missing from this table is a year this product or service was not reported in, not a year of no spending.

What this data cannot show

  • The fiscal year is not over. These are obligations recorded so far, and a figure here is not comparable with a full year.
  • An obligation is a binding commitment to pay, not money paid. Outlays are reported separately and the two are never equal in the same year.
  • The Product and Service Code says what was bought, which is a different question from who sold it. Contracts only: an assistance award has no product code.
